Transaction d753c077f60a79dc207c5ffe31f20c06ed637adb166cb79aae8a39d2dbbfa139
1 Input
1 Output
-
d753c077f60a79dc207c5ffe31f20c06ed637adb166cb79aae8a39d2dbbfa139:0
- value
- 70778
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 57128a9bdd0e912f3fd0447fae3ec0184e6441d7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18wPzyKubY4vwxLAKyEjq8sJHQyRQpMZCV